Motivational Keys That Keep Your Weight Loss On Track

Losing weight is just as much a mental undertaking as a physical one.  A strong mental focus on the end goal is just as important as the right diet. Even if you've struggled to lose weight in the past, you will find it much easier to succeed if you incorporate these tips to stay focused and motivated for weight loss success.

Reasons Why

The easiest way to stay motivated is to clearly identify your reasons for wanting to lose weight. Before you start a diet or exercise regimen, grab a piece of paper and spend some time thinking of the real reasons you want to shed pounds. While part of you may just want to be healthier and have more energy, you may have other reasons for losing weight as well. For example, maybe you want to appear more attractive to the opposite sex.

By uncovering these underlying reasons, you will find it much easier to stay motivated. Keep your list of reasons handy, and refer back to them often. Being clear about why you really want to lose weight will actually make your desire stronger, and make it easier to complete your goal.

Taking Photos

Another great solution for staying motivated is taking photos. Commit to taking a photo of yourself every week or so. This will give you enough time to make noticeable progress.

For these photos to be effective, you should make sure you take the photo in underwear, a bathing suit, or even naked, if that is something you are comfortable with. You should also take the photo in the same type of clothing for each session.

To make this technique really powerful, incorporate visualizations. Have your journal ready, and jot down how you feel when you take your picture. Each time you take a photo, identify and write down what's changed. At the end of each session, visualize yourself being even slimmer for the next photo. This technique is an extremely powerful tool that will help you lose weight.

Losing weight does not have to be as difficult if as you think. Even if you've struggled to lose weight in the past, by staying motivated, you can stay focused and will start to see results. Once you start to lose weight, the physical evidence of the photos will motivate you even further.
